Vice presidential candidate Mike Pence spoke Wednesday, extolling traditional conservative values, but the real stage stealer was Ted Cruz, who did not endorse Trump and got booed off stage. “No big deal,” Trump tweeted:

Wow, Ted Cruz got booed off the stage, didn’t honor the pledge! I saw his speech two hours early but let him speak anyway. No big deal!

— Donald J. Trump (@realDonaldTrump) July 21, 2016
